Aikido researchers uncovered ChainDrop, a Shai-Hulud variant infecting over 1,300 npm packages with an infostealer. Attackers compromised GitHub accounts tied to Keyv, Cacheable, flat-cache, and file-entry-cache, pushing tainted releases with 2B monthly downloads. Malware exfiltrates credentials to a public GitHub repo; admins should treat systems as compromised.
